Reduced risk of chronic GVHD by low-dose rATG in adult matched sibling donor peripheral blood stem cell transplantation for hematologic malignancies

Abstract

The optimal rabbit anti-thymocyte globulin (rATG) graft-versus-host disease (GVHD) prophylaxis regimen in matched sibling donor peripheral blood stem cell transplantation (MSD-PBSCT) remains to be elucidated. In this prospective study, we used low-dose rATG for GVHD prophylaxis in patients or donors aged ≥ 40 years with hematological malignancies receiving MSD-PBSCT. rATG was administered to 40 patients at an intravenous dose of 5 mg/kg divided over day 5 and day 4 before graft infusion. No graft failure occurred. Median times to leukocyte engraftment and platelet engraftment were 11.0 days and 13.9 days. The cumulative incidence of grades 2-4 and grades 3-4 acute GVHD at day +100 was 30.0% and 2.6%. The 2-year cumulative incidence of extensive chronic GVHD and severe chronic GVHD was 11.4% and 14.7%. 93.5% (29/31) of patients had discontinued immunosuppressive medication within 3 years after transplantation. The 2-year cumulative incidence of transplant-related mortality (TRM) and relapse was 14.0% and 22.6%. The cumulative incidence of cytomegalovirus reactivation, Epstein-Barr virus reactivation, and fungal infection was 22.3%, 12.9%, and 12.5%. Kaplan-Meier estimates for overall survival, disease-free survival, and GVHD-free and relapse-free survival 3 years after transplantation were 68.9%, 68.9%, and 54.0%. rATG for GVHD prophylaxis is tolerable and efficacious at a 5 mg/kg total dose administered over 2 days (days -5 to -4) in patients receiving allogeneic MSD-PBSCT.
